Throughout their career, Yassine Boualam has won 6 titles: Super Cup (2024/2025, 2023/2024), Presidents Cup (2024/2025), UAE-Qatar Challenge Shield (2025), UAE-Qatar Super Shield (2024), and Pro League (2024/2025) with Shabab Al-Ahli Dubai FC.
